    what is the smallest over hang face frame hinge?

    I meant to make the doors hang over the face frame by 1/2" but I did not read my own instructions carefully enough and now I only have enough door width for 1/4" overlay.

    I have not assembled the doors yet and can just make larger rails and stiles If I need to but would rather not.

    Is there a 1/4" overlay hinge?

    I presume that your talking about euro style hinges on face frame.

    Couldn't find 1/4" but Blum makes a compact 3/8" overlay. Might be able to tweak the cup hole a little closer to the edge of the door to approach your 1/4". If you drill your hole closer to the edge just be careful and consider the effect on the edge profile you cut on the face side of your doors.

    Blum series 33 compact/concealed FF hinges come in 1/4" overlay.

    Blum crank arm (71t5650) with zero plate and bored properly will do it.

    (Or straight arm and 9mm plate).
